溫馨提示×

redis get如何獲取數(shù)據(jù)

小樊
81
2024-11-06 14:51:51
欄目: 云計算

在Redis中,GET命令用于從數(shù)據(jù)庫中獲取指定鍵的值。以下是使用GET命令的基本語法:

GET key

其中,key是你要獲取值的鍵。如果鍵存在,GET命令將返回對應(yīng)的值;如果鍵不存在,GET命令將返回nil。

以下是一些使用GET命令的示例:

  1. 獲取一個存在的鍵的值:
> SET mykey "Hello, Redis!"
OK
> GET mykey
"Hello, Redis!"
  1. 獲取一個不存在的鍵的值:
> GET non_existent_key
(nil)
  1. 嘗試獲取一個類型不匹配的鍵的值(例如,嘗試獲取一個列表的值):
> SET mylist "item1"
OK
> GET mylist
(error) ERR key is of the wrong type

請注意,GET命令只能用于獲取字符串類型的值。如果你需要獲取其他類型的值(如列表、集合、哈希表等),你需要使用相應(yīng)的命令(如LRANGESMEMBERS、HGETALL等)。

0